BAYFRONT SHUTTLE SUMMER HOURS

Post Date:05/11/2026 12:51 PM

The City of Chula Vista is making it even easier for residents and visitors to explore its scenic waterfront this summer. The Chula Vista Bayfront Shuttle is expanding service hours on its Green Line and introducing new features to enhance rider convenience and accessibility.

Beginning this summer, the Green Line will operate daily from 8 a.m. to 9 p.m., extending evening access to the bayfront and surrounding communities. The Blue Line will continue to run from 8 a.m. to 6 p.m. To accommodate growing demand, the City is also adding a fifth all-electric shuttle to the fleet, increasing service capacity and reducing wait times.

The shuttle now offers live tracking, allowing passengers to view real-time arrival and departure information directly on the City website. This new feature provides up-to-date scheduling information, reducing uncertainty and making public transportation a more dependable option.

The Chula Vista Bayfront Shuttle provides no-cost, emissions-free rides connecting the shoreline to key destinations, including the Living Coast Discovery Center, Downtown Chula Vista, Chula Vista Center, residential communities, parks and existing trolley stations. Each electric shuttle van is fully equipped to meet ADA accessibility needs, ensuring inclusive transportation for all riders.

Since launching in June 2025, the shuttle has experienced steady growth in ridership. Usage has consistently increased in the months since, surpassing 16,000 total rides as of March 2026.

"We’re excited to expand Bayfront Shuttle service just in time for summer, with longer hours, added capacity, and new real-time tracking to better serve our community,” said Mayor John McCann. “This free, emissions-free service makes it easier for residents and visitors to explore the bayfront while supporting local businesses and a more connected, sustainable Chula Vista."

The shuttle program is a central feature of the Chula Vista Bayfront Master Plan’s Public Access Program, which emphasizes the public’s right to shoreline access and supports a robust network of pedestrian, bicycle, transit and auto connections. The City of Chula Vista is proud to partner with the San Diego Metropolitan Transit System (MTS) to deliver this vital community service.
